Saving Your Loved One from Gambling's Grip

It’s heartbreaking to see a loved one consumed by gambling. Their obsession can destroy relationships, finances, and their overall happiness. But there is hope. You can be a beacon of support for them during this challenging time. Begin by reaching out with love and concern. Express your worries without judgment, emphasizing that you care them unconditionally.

Encourage them to get professional treatment. Professional therapists and counselors are trained to assist individuals struggling with gambling addiction. They can provide coping mechanisms, therapy options, and a safe space for your loved one to address their feelings. Remember, you’re how to help a problem gambler not alone in this battle. There are resources available to help both your loved one and you.

Playing Smart : A Guide to Ethical Gambling

Gambling can be a fun, but it's crucial to approach it responsibly. Ethical gambling involves managing your bankroll and understanding the chances involved. Resist the urge with money you can't risk. Remember, gambling should remain a leisure activity, not a means to get rich quick.

  • Establish financial boundaries before you start gambling and remain within it.
  • Step away from the table to avoid overspending.
  • Seek help if you feel your gambling is becoming problematic.

Conquer the Casino

Wanna know the secret to winning at gambling? It's not about getting lucky – it's about understanding the game and playing smart. First, choose games with a low house edge, like blackjack or craps. Learn basic techniques and practice patience. Don't fall for common gambler's fallacies – betting more after a loss won't change the odds! Set a budget, stick to it, and know when to quit.

  • Memorize basic strategy charts for blackjack.
  • Master the rules of craps inside and out.
  • Avoid chasing losses with bigger bets.

Remember, gambling should be fun. Don't let it dominate your life. Play responsibly and you can increase your chances of winning.
